Transaction d7ce958671524caa8e23c47a37a750c1827e0555a0c96451b701561f3336acbf
1 Input
1 Output
-
d7ce958671524caa8e23c47a37a750c1827e0555a0c96451b701561f3336acbf:0
- value
- 104562686
- script pubkey
- OP_0 OP_PUSHBYTES_20 86fbb95a9d9046b9f354d22e5823dd42802a8f34
- address
- bc1qsmamjk5ajprtnu656gh9sg7ag2qz4re5thlsaw